Chronic joint disorders are conditions that lead to long-term pain, stiffness, and inflammation in the joints. These conditions may result from age-related wear and tear, autoimmune diseases, past injuries, or biomechanical imbalances. Common symptoms include:
Joint stiffness and reduced range of motion
Swelling and tenderness in affected areas
Persistent pain that worsens with movement or inactivity
Muscle weakness around the affected joint
Chiropractic care focuses on restoring proper joint alignment and function through hands-on techniques and therapeutic modalities. Here’s how it benefits those with chronic joint disorders:
1. Spinal and Joint Adjustments
Misaligned joints can contribute to pain and reduced mobility. Chiropractic adjustments help realign the spine and extremity joints, improving function and reducing discomfort. Proper joint alignment also alleviates unnecessary stress on surrounding tissues.
2. Soft Tissue Therapy
Chiropractors utilize soft tissue techniques, such as myofascial release and trigger point therapy, to reduce muscle tension and improve circulation around affected joints. This helps decrease inflammation and promotes healing.
3. Improved Joint Mobility
Restricted joints can cause compensatory movements that lead to further discomfort. Chiropractic care enhances joint mobility through targeted mobilization techniques, helping to restore a natural range of motion.
4. Inflammation Reduction
Chronic joint disorders are often associated with inflammation, which exacerbates pain and stiffness. Chiropractic treatments support the body’s natural ability to reduce inflammation through spinal adjustments, lifestyle recommendations, and nutritional guidance.
5. Postural and Movement Corrections
Poor posture and improper movement patterns can contribute to joint pain. Chiropractors assess posture and provide corrective exercises to help patients improve their biomechanics, reducing strain on affected joints.
